Subject: SQL lint cut-over — done

Hi all,

We finished moving the Tidequery repo onto the new SqlNeat ruleset last night. All 400-ish migration files now pass; the three gnarly ones got inline waivers with comments explaining why. CI blocks on violations going forward, so no more sneaky tab-indented joins. For anyone maintaining this later, the linter runs with these configuration values.

service settings:
[druius]
team = wenael
access_code = ac_8a6f89
owner = keleth.briius
host = druius.nelvrocorp.example
port = 3306
peer = tamix.tolvaqforge.example
salt = 97259282
pin = 0863

Handover: Kioskbird watchdog. It pings the kiosk app every 20s; three misses triggers restart, ten triggers reboot. Logs land in the local journal, rotated daily. Don't disable it to debug — use maintenance mode instead, or you'll fight auto-restarts. Escalate hardware reboots to the ops channel. New folks: memorize the watchdog's current configuration values, shown below.

deployment values, yadup-kadug:
[sorys]
port = 5672
team = noveth
host = sorys.orvexcorp.example
region = south-4
access_code = ac_deddc1
timeout_ms = 1500

**Q: Why does the StageGrid seat-map renderer show gaps in the balcony rows at the Corvander Theatre?**

A: The balcony at Corvander has irregular row offsets, and StageGrid falls back to a rectangular layout when the venue manifest omits curvature data. This is expected, not a bug. Before filing anything, verify the manifest version and re-run the layout validator. The full explanation, with annotated screenshots, lives on the internal page below.

wiki page, tahaf-tajog: https://jira.ordindyn.corp/pipeline

**Action Item: Ledger Drift Guardrail.** During the Pointsmith incident, the loyalty-points ledger accepted duplicate accrual events for roughly forty minutes before reconciliation caught the drift. Owner: the Vexbird platform team. We will add an idempotency check at the accrual gateway and a nightly balance audit, targeted for the next minor release. The full remediation checklist and rollout gating criteria are documented on the internal page below.

dashboard of yahaf-kajep = https://jira.zemvarsys.internal/display/projects/browse/browse/a08b